CONTEXT: Measurements of thyroglobulin (Tg) and Tg antibodies are crucial in the follow-up of treated differentiated thyroid cancer (DTC) patients. Interassay differences may significantly impact follow-up.Entities:

Overview of the thyroglobulin and thyroglobulin antibody assays used in this study
| Measurand | Assay | Reference range | Source reference range | Standardization | Functional sensitivity |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Tg | LIAISON® | 0.9-54 ng/mL | 167 euthyroid subjects | CRM 45721,22 | 0.17 ng/mL |
| Kryptor | 1.6-61.3 ng/mL | 207 healthy subjects | CRM 45721,22 | 0.15 ng/mL | |
| Cobas | 3.5-77 ng/mL | 478 healthy Caucasian subjects | CRM 45721,22 | Not given by manufacturer | |
| Tg-PluS | 1.7-35 ng/mL | Unknown | CRM 45721,22 | 0.2 ng/mL | |
| Tg antibody | LIAISON® | 5-100 IU/mL | 193 healthy subjects | MRC 65/93 | 10 IU/mL |
| Kryptor | ≤33 U/mL | 206 healthy subjects | MRC 65/93 | 33 U/mL | |
| Cobas | ≤115 IU/mL | 392 healthy subjects | MRC 65/93 | Not given by manufacturer | |
| Phadia EliA | <40 IU/mL = negative | Unknown | MRC 65/93 | Not given by manufacturer | |
| >60 IU/mL = positive |
Abbreviation: Tg, thyroglobulin.
